Blood pressure (abbreviated BP) is the pressure of blood against the walls of a vessel. The rhythmic beating nature of that pressure, caused by the alternating ventricular contraction and relaxation in the heart, is the pulse (abbreviated P).Blood pressure has two values - the systolic blood pressure and the diastolic blood pressure.When the heart beats, it pushes blood through the arteries to all of the tissues in the body. It is at this point that the pressure from the blood against the artery walls is at its highest and this value is the systolic blood pressure.When the heart is at rest, in between beats, the pressure on the artery walls is much lower and this value is known as the diastolic blood pressure.blood pressure

The physiological relationship between heart rate and blood pressure is that they are closely connected. When the heart beats faster, it pumps more blood, which can increase blood pressure. Conversely, when the heart beats slower, blood pressure may decrease. This relationship is important for maintaining proper circulation and overall cardiovascular health.
Heart rate refers to the number of times your heart beats per minute, while blood pressure is the force of blood against the walls of your arteries. Heart rate is measured in beats per minute, while blood pressure is measured in millimeters of mercury (mmHg).
